Things mentioned in this video:
Chapters:
0:00 Start
0:05 Step 1: Increase toe splay
2:18 Step 2: Exercise the Foot Arch Muscles
3:46 Step 3: Enhance ground feel
5:37 Step 4: Improve Ankle Mobility
7:00 Step 5: Strengthen The Glutes

Does walking in flip-flops help any? Thanks for the videos!
There are Y'tubes answering this question. The answer is ff wearers tend to turn their feet inward in order to keep the ff from falling off. Resulting in a pigeon toed gait. Same for those wearing sliders.Over time ff and sliders are damaging to ones walk. Wear a sandal with an ankle strap and toe box so that the sandal stays on effortlessly
